/**
* Test case for parsing zip files.
*/
public class ZipParserTest extends AbstractPkgTest {
/**
* Tests that the ParseContext parser is correctly
* fired for all the embedded entries.
*/
@Test
public void testEmbedded() throws Exception {
ContentHandler handler = new BodyContentHandler();
Metadata metadata = new Metadata();
try (InputStream stream = getResourceAsStream("/test-documents/test-documents.zip")) {
AUTO_DETECT_PARSER.parse(stream, handler, metadata, trackingContext);
}
// Should have found all 9 documents
assertEquals(9, tracker.filenames.size());
assertEquals(9, tracker.mediatypes.size());
assertEquals(9, tracker.modifiedAts.size());
// Should have names and modified dates, but not content types,
// as zip doesn't store the content types
assertEquals("testEXCEL.xls", tracker.filenames.get(0));
assertEquals("testHTML.html", tracker.filenames.get(1));
assertEquals("testOpenOffice2.odt", tracker.filenames.get(2));
assertEquals("testPDF.pdf", tracker.filenames.get(3));
assertEquals("testPPT.ppt", tracker.filenames.get(4));
assertEquals("testRTF.rtf", tracker.filenames.get(5));
assertEquals("testTXT.txt", tracker.filenames.get(6));
assertEquals("testWORD.doc", tracker.filenames.get(7));
assertEquals("testXML.xml", tracker.filenames.get(8));
for (String type : tracker.mediatypes) {
assertNull(type);
}
for (String crt : tracker.createdAts) {
assertNull(crt);
}
for (String mod : tracker.modifiedAts) {
assertNotNull(mod);
assertTrue("Modified at " + mod, mod.startsWith("20"));
}
}
/**
* Test case for the ability of the ZIP parser to extract the name of
* a ZIP entry even if the content of the entry is unreadable due to an
* unsupported compression method.
*
* @see <a href="https://issues.apache.org/jira/browse/TIKA-346">TIKA-346</a>
*/
@Test
public void testUnsupportedZipCompressionMethod() throws Exception {
String content = new Tika().parseToString(getResourceAsStream("/test-documents/moby.zip"));
assertContains("README", content);
}
